The Summer Food Service Program (SFSP), also known as the Summer Meals Program, is funded by the United States Department of Agriculture (USDA) and administered by the Illinois State Board of Education (ISBE) to provide FREE meals over the summer to kids 18 and under. At meal sites, children can receive a healthy meal in a safe place.
There are open sites and closed sites for free meals. Open sites are meal sites where anyone age 18 and under can get a free meal. There is no fee, no sign-up, and no proof of identity or legal status required.
